import copy
from operator import itemgetter
from uuid import UUID
from oslo_serialization import jsonutils
from oslo_utils import uuidutils
from tempest import config
from tempest.lib.common.utils import data_utils
from tempest.lib import decorators
from tempest.lib import exceptions
from octavia_tempest_plugin.common import constants as const
from octavia_tempest_plugin.tests import test_base
CONF = config.CONF
class AvailabilityZoneProfileAPITest(test_base.LoadBalancerBaseTest):
"""Test the availability zone profile object API."""
@classmethod
def skip_checks(cls):
super(AvailabilityZoneProfileAPITest, cls).skip_checks()
if (CONF.load_balancer.availability_zone is None and
not CONF.load_balancer.test_with_noop):
raise cls.skipException(
'Availability zone profile API tests require an availability '
'zone configured in the [load_balancer] availability_zone '
'setting in the tempest configuration file.')
@decorators.idempotent_id('e512b580-ef32-44c3-bbd2-efdc27ba2ea6')
def test_availability_zone_profile_create(self):
"""Tests availability zone profile create and basic show APIs.
* Tests that users without the loadbalancer admin role cannot
create availability zone profiles.
* Create a fully populated availability zone profile.
* Validate the response reflects the requested values.
"""
# We have to do this here as the api_version and clients are not
# setup in time to use a decorator or the skip_checks mixin
if not (
self.lb_admin_availability_zone_profile_client
.is_version_supported(self.api_version, '2.14')):
raise self.skipException(
'Availability zone profiles are only available on '
'Octavia API version 2.14 or newer.')
availability_zone_profile_name = data_utils.rand_name(
"lb_admin_availabilityzoneprofile1-create")
availability_zone_data = {
const.COMPUTE_ZONE: CONF.load_balancer.availability_zone,
const.MANAGEMENT_NETWORK: uuidutils.generate_uuid(),
}
availability_zone_data_json = jsonutils.dumps(availability_zone_data)
availability_zone_profile_kwargs = {
const.NAME: availability_zone_profile_name,
const.PROVIDER_NAME: CONF.load_balancer.provider,
const.AVAILABILITY_ZONE_DATA: availability_zone_data_json
}
# Test that a user without the load balancer admin role cannot
# create an availability zone profile.
expected_allowed = []
if CONF.load_balancer.RBAC_test_type == const.OWNERADMIN:
expected_allowed = ['os_admin', 'os_roles_lb_admin']
if CONF.load_balancer.RBAC_test_type == const.KEYSTONE_DEFAULT_ROLES:
expected_allowed = ['os_system_admin', 'os_roles_lb_admin']
if CONF.load_balancer.RBAC_test_type == const.ADVANCED:
expected_allowed = ['os_system_admin', 'os_roles_lb_admin']
if expected_allowed:
self.check_create_RBAC_enforcement(
'availability_zone_profile_client',
'create_availability_zone_profile',
expected_allowed, **availability_zone_profile_kwargs)
# Happy path
availability_zone_profile = (
self.lb_admin_availability_zone_profile_client
.create_availability_zone_profile(
**availability_zone_profile_kwargs))
self.addCleanup(
self.lb_admin_availability_zone_profile_client
.cleanup_availability_zone_profile,
availability_zone_profile[const.ID])
UUID(availability_zone_profile[const.ID])
self.assertEqual(
availability_zone_profile_name,
availability_zone_profile[const.NAME])
self.assertEqual(
CONF.load_balancer.provider,
availability_zone_profile[const.PROVIDER_NAME])
self.assertEqual(
availability_zone_data_json,
availability_zone_profile[const.AVAILABILITY_ZONE_DATA])
# Testing that availability_zone_profiles do not support tags
availability_zone_profile_tags = ["Hello", "World"]
tags_availability_zone_profile_kwargs = (
availability_zone_profile_kwargs.copy())
tags_availability_zone_profile_kwargs[const.TAGS] = (
availability_zone_profile_tags)
az_profile_client = self.lb_admin_availability_zone_profile_client
self.assertRaises(TypeError,
az_profile_client.create_availability_zone_profile,
**tags_availability_zone_profile_kwargs)
